How you’ll make an impact in this role

  • Perform basic clinical and non-clinical patient care activities under the supervision of nursing or medical staff.

  • Assist with the movement, transfer, positioning, and placement of patients to support safety and comfort.

  • Help patients with personal hygiene, grooming, and other activities of daily living.

  • Observe and report changes in patients’ physical, mental, and emotional conditions to the nursing staff and document necessary records accurately.

  • Maintain clean and orderly patient rooms while ensuring medical equipment is properly maintained and organized.

What minimum requirements you’ll need

Licensure / Certification / Registration:

  • BLS Provider obtained within 1 Month (30 days) of hire date or job transfer date required. American Heart Association or American Red Cross accepted.

  • One or more of the following:

  • Emergency Medical Tech credentialed from the Illinois Board Of Division of Emergency Medical Services and Highway Safety obtained prior to hire date or job transfer date required. Intermediate or Advanced also acceptable.

  • Practical/Vocational Nurse credentialed from the Illinois Department of Financial and Professional Regulation obtained prior to hire date or job transfer date required.

  • Nurse Aide credentialed from the Illinois Department of Public Health obtained prior to hire date or job transfer date required. Nursing student who has completed on semester of medical surgical nursing is also acceptable.

Education:

  • High School diploma equivalency OR 1 year of applicable cumulative job specific experience required.

  • Note: Required professional licensure/certification can be used in lieu of education or experience, if applicable.
